البرمجة الكائنية في بايثون - سلسلة بايثونات لتعلم لغة البايثون

البرمجة الكائنية في بايثون – سلسلة بايثونات لتعلم لغة البايثون

أهلا وسهلًا بكم في آخر مقال من سلسلة بايثونات لتعلم البايثون والذي نتناول فيه موضوع البرمجة الكائنية Object Oriented Programming والتي يختصرها جمع المبرمجون إلى OPP. البرمجة الكائنية في بايثون تُشبه لحد كبير البرمجة الكائنية في العديد من لغات البرمجة الأخرى ولكن مع وجود اختلافات.

استمر في القراءة

أداة virtualenv كأداة لتسهيل البرمجة والعمل بلغة البايثون

أداة virtualenv كأداة لتسهيل البرمجة والعمل بلغة البايثون

من المهم شرح أداة virtualenv لتسهيل العمل أثناء البرمجة بالبايثون. لأنك كمبرمج بايثون، من المؤكد أنك مررت في حالة تريد فيها أن يعمل برنامجك على توزيعتي البايثون 3.5 و 2.7. أو أنك تريد أن تقوم ببناء شيفرة برمجية باستخدام مكتبة مُثبتة لديك ولكن بإصدار أقل أو أعلى، فهل في هذه الحالة ستقوم بحذف المكتبة وإعادة تثبيتها بالإصدار الذي تريد. ماذا عن الحالة الأولى والتي يظن البعض بانها مرعبة، حيث قد يتساءل أحدهم كيف سأثبت إصدارين من البايثون على نفس نظام التشغيل، وكيف سأتعامل مع ذلك؟!

استمر في القراءة

تطبيقات البايثون في التعامل مع محرر النصوص مايكروسوفت وورد

تطبيقات البايثون في التعامل مع محرر النصوص مايكروسوفت وورد

في إطار شرح مفاهيم بايثون بالعربي نُقدم لكم في هذا المقال شرحاً مبسطاً لأحد المكتبات. يندرج ما تقدمه هذه المكتبة تحت عنوان أتمتة المهام الدورية  Automate The Boring Stuff و تطبيقات البايثون .

استمر في القراءة